Nonlinear Systems
-
Nullclines & Jacobian Linearization Explorer — interactive explainer
See how nullclines locate equilibria, what the Jacobian linearization reveals about their stability, and what the nullcline geometry can and cannot show on its own.
-
Lyapunov Level-Set Explorer — interactive explainer
Explore Lyapunov functions and level-set curves for common nonlinear dynamical systems, then synthesize them automatically with sum-of-squares programming that exports runnable MATLAB and Python code.
-
Multi-Scroll Attractors & Hyperchaos — interactive primer
Explore multi-scroll chaotic attractors and hyperchaos, and how their dynamics underpin image-encryption schemes.
